Job Summary:
You will support the development and test of new camera products based on SIONYX’s ground-breaking ultra-low light image sensors. Your electrical engineering design skills, troubleshooting and failure analysis skills will drive the continuous improvement of SIONYX products.
Critical to the role is rapidly learning new camera designs. This is an engineering role and therefore you must be comfortable doing direct design and hands-on work. You will work closely with SIONYX engineering and operations teams to ensure that designs and manufacturing processes result in world-class camera products. You will also interact directly with customers to understand and resolve any electrical issues they have encountered.
You must be a hands-on engineer, well versed in mixed-signal circuits and comfortable working in the laboratory environment. You will demonstrate breadth in your technical knowledge, precision in your communication, and thoroughness in your documentation process.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
- Schematic capture and layout tools for circuit board design
- Understanding and implementing designs from technical drawings
- Knowledge of SW/HW interfaces including imaging sensors, displays, batteries, buttons and other camera peripheral devices
- Debug and failure analysis of camera hardware and/or firmware, through the use of built-in diagnostics, electrical probing / testing, and working with 3rd party FA vendors
- Designing and implementing test procedures to evaluate new electronics hardware
- Testing electronics for problems and proposing solutions
- Supporting reliability and accelerated lifetime testing
- Repair and/or modification of electronic circuits
- Soldering for small components
- Interface with operations team to drive continuous improvement
- Interacting with customers to understand their requirements and any issues or failures
- Communicating to customers progress, challenges, and risk mitigation
- Creating product documentation and records using standard software tools as well as Excel, Powerpoint and Word
